Ranking of areas with best air quality revealing for regions of the Southwest
Three areas in the American southwest represent the best and worst in air quality according to a new report. Using data from the Environmental Protection Agency, SmartSurvey scored areas using 12 factors to rate air quality, including the number of good and bad days, and average pollution measures. FIRST ALERT FORECAST: Temps to get even warmer soon
YUMA, Ariz. (KYMA, KECY) - Above normal temperatures will continue into the weekend. Lower desert afternoon high temperatures in the middle to upper 90s through the middle part of the week, increasing into the 100 to 105 range Friday into Sunday. Yuma homeowner’s fence height request denied by the city
The City of Yuma held a public hearing Thursday morning after a homeowner requested to increase the allowable fence height in their front yard from 30 inches to 7 feet. The post Yuma homeowner’s fence height request denied by the city appeared first on KYMA.
